      Why does the liftback have a rear wiper?
      There is no aerodynamic reason for one to be there. The back window accumulates no more dirt or dust than a typical three box sedan like a Commodore or Falcon. Conventional two box hatch backs like say Corollas or Mazda 3s need a wiper because dirt is sucked up from the road onto the window by the vortex created from air flowing over the roof. Three box cars have the road dirt accumulate on the rear lights and back of the boot because of this effect this is what happens on the Octavia hatch.
      The only reason I can see it being there is marketing and customer perception.
      Our Audi S3 always has a filthy rear window and the rear wiper gets used a lot on my Octavia which is largely driven on the same roads the rear window says relatively clean and is only really affected by airborne dust and dirt landing on it when it's parked.

                    • Originally posted by The Speedfighter View Post
                      Sorry, but what are three box shapes??
                      As above sedans. Box one is the bonnet, box two is the passenger compartment and box three is the boot area.
                      Hatches and SUVs are only two box (not boot obviously).
                      Vans are one box.
